Abstract
In this study, we found autophagy inhibitors 3-MA and LY294002 reduced osteoclast differentiation and osteoclast-related genes in vitro. In vivo, 3-MA and LY294002 repressed titanium particle-stimulated inflammatory osteolysis and osteoclastogenesis.
